HTTP сервис в 1С предоставляет возможность обмена данными между информационными базами 1С и внешними системами. Для того чтобы выполнить запрос к HTTP сервису 1С с авторизацией, необходимо пройти следующие шаги.
1. Создание пользователя и роли в информационной базе 1С. Для этого необходимо зайти в конфигурацию информационной базы, перейти в раздел Пользователи и роли и создать нового пользователя с необходимыми правами доступа.
2. Настройка прав доступа к HTTP сервису. Для этого необходимо зайти в настройки HTTP сервиса и указать роль, которая будет иметь доступ к выполнению запросов.
3. Формирование запроса к HTTP сервису. Для формирования запроса необходимо использовать специальный объект встроенного языка запросов 1С — HTTPСоединение. В запросе необходимо указать URL сервиса, метод запроса (GET, POST и т.д.), данные запроса (если необходимо) и заголовки запроса.
4. Авторизация при выполнении запроса. Для авторизации при выполнении запроса необходимо передать данные авторизации в заголовке запроса. Это может быть логин и пароль пользователя, либо токен авторизации.
5. Обработка ответа от HTTP сервиса. После выполнения запроса необходимо обработать ответ от сервиса. В ответе может содержаться необходимая информация или ошибка, которую необходимо обработать.
Таким образом, выполнение запроса к HTTP сервису 1С с авторизацией требует выполнения нескольких шагов, начиная от настройки пользователя и роли в информационной базе, заканчивая обработкой ответа от сервиса. Важно правильно настроить авторизацию при выполнении запроса, чтобы обеспечить безопасность передаваемых данных.
© KiberSec.ru – 05.04.2025, обновлено 05.04.2025
Перепечатка материалов сайта возможна только с разрешения администрации KiberSec.ru.